VOV.VN - Vietnam’s investments abroad, including newly and additionally-registered capital during the first quarter of the year, reached US$211.45 million, or 37% of the figure recorded the same period in 2021.

VOV.VN - Registered foreign direct investment (FDI) capital into the nation reached over US$8.9 billion as of March 20, equaling 87.9% over the same period in 2021, according to data provided by the Foreign Investment Agency under the Ministry of Planning and Investment.
